Benefits of Neem Oil: Natural Treatment for Psoriasis, Eczema & Acne

Recently, I have been hearing a lot about neem oil as a natural treatment for severe skin conditions like acne, eczema and psoriasis. Our Healthy Being Stores carries TheraNeem skin products and I decided to start using them in my natural skin care routine. I've been amazed by the texture and look of my skin and decided to find out the significant benefits behind this obscure product that reaches beyond skin care.
I've gotten more and more involved in Ayurvedic Medicne and Healing and Neem is deeply rooted in this practice. The antibacterial, antifungal & blood purifying properties of Neem are useful in skin disorders, dental health, diabetes management, immune support and even fighting cancer.
BENEFITS OF NEEM
- Useful as a tonic and astringent that promotes wound healing
- Has detoxifying benefits that help maintain healthy circulatory, digestive, respiratory, and urinary systems
- Extract possesses anti-diabetic, anti-bacterial, and anti-viral properties
- Beneficial in treating malarial fever and cutaneous diseases
All the parts of the plant and active principles and extracts possess a lot of significant pharmacological properties. Neem is bitter and alterative. It is used as a poultice in boils, is antiseptic, demulcent, a tonic in catarrhal affections, stomachic, stimulant. It is useful in snake bite, scorpion sting, hypoglycemic, in rheumatism, as an analgesic, antipyretic, sedative, antibacterial, antiprotozoal, antiviral, anthelmintic and in skin diseases. The tree stem, root and bark possess astringent, tonic, and antiperiodic properties. The bark is beneficial in malarial fever and useful in cutaneous diseases.
NEEM USES:Psoriasis:
Sheryll Zenganeh the publisher of "Empress Press", a national newsletter for people with psoriasis and other serious skin conditions, has promoted the effectiveness of Neem. Sheryll suffered from Psoriasis for seventeen years before she came in contact with Neem. She stated in her newsletter that "today, thanks to Neem, my psoriasis is virtually gone and I now has soft, supple, youthful, gorgeous skin."
In clinical studies Neem extracts and oil were found to be as effective as coal tar and cortisone in treating psoriasis. However there were none of the usual side effects accompanying the use of Neem as there was with Coal tar and cortisone. When applied to the skin, Neem extracts and oil removed the redness and itching while improving the condition of the skin for the duration of the treatment.
Eczema:
In the case of eczema clinical studies demonstrate that even the application of weaker Neem leaf extracts effectively cured acute conditions of eczema, what to speak of the fresh cold pressed oil with its high concentration of active ingredients. Using a Soap or shampoo containing Neem oil can easily relieve the itching and redness of eczema. For specific areas of intensity on your skin apply Neem cream after bathing and/or shampooing with Neem oil products.
Acne:
Neem effectively kills the bacteria that cause Acne and studies prove that Neem will reduce inflammation, even the inflammation produced by Acne.
Skin problems in general:
Dry Skin, Wrinkles, Dandruff, Itchy Scalp, Skin Ulcers and Warts are other conditions that can be effectively resolved by the use of soaps, lotions, and creams, containing Neem leaf extracts and oil.
Neem's effectiveness against Periodontal Disease
Throughout India and South East Asia hundreds of millions of village people use Neem twigs and leaves to brush their teeth, and keep their gums free of disease and infection even though they have limited access to modern dental care. The ancient Ayurvedic practice of using Neem to heal and rejuvenate gum tissue and to prevent cavities and gum disease is verified in modern clinical studies.
Studies showed that Neem bark is more active then the leaves against certain bacteria and that Neem based tooth pastes and mouth washes significantly improved Pyorrhea, at various stages, in 70 patients. In another study Neem toothpaste prevented and even reversed gingivitis.

Arthritis:
Traditionally Ayurveda has recommended the use of Neem leaf, seed, and bark, for reducing arthritic pain and inflammation and for halting the progression of the disease as well. The use of Neem for these purposes has been confirmed by modern clinical studies.
The pain, inflammation, and swelling of the joints in arthritis can be greatly reduced by different compounds in Neem. In numerous clinical studies the polysaccharides and other compounds of Neem leaf extract have produced a reduction in the inflammation caused by arthritis. One of the major components in Neem seed, which has demonstrated a significant effect against arthritis, is nimbidin. Other components that possess anti-inflammatory properties are limonoids and catechin.
There are several reasons why the compounds in Neem work so well. It appears that these compounds make a number of adjustments to various mechanisms in the body, which explains their anti-inflammatory effects. There is an inhibition in the release of mediators of acute inflammation, an antihistaminic effect, and a modification in the functioning of the immune system response. This last effect is extremely important. Neem's ability to change the way the immune system responds to arthritis, by reducing the generation of inflammation producing chemicals, may also be the reason why it halts the progress of the disease and why it may hold the promise of an actual cure.
In addition to its anti-inflammatory effects there are several leaf compounds like the above mentioned polysaccharides, catechin, and limonoids, which are clinically proven to be more potent than aspirin (acetylsalicylic acid) in decreasing prostaglandin synthetase and the pain it causes.

Treating Eczema Naturally- Preventing Eczema & Psoriasis Outbreaks

I have a few close friends who suffer from Eczema. It has been extremely challenging for them; especially when one had an outbreak right before her wedding. Luckily, there are a few natural treatments that combat eczema and psoriasis orally and topically.
Often eczema can be the directly the result of a deficiency in essential nutrients like omega 3 fatty acids, blood toxicity and even leaky gut syndrome. Certain types of fat-metabolism malfunctions are more often found in patients suffering from eczema and psoriasis than in the rest of the population. Therefore diet and specialized skin care routines are necessary to balance the root cause of the eczema and psoriasis outbreaks.
Eating Salmon, seaweed salad, flaxseed and consuming Vitamin E, Omega 3 Fish Oil Supplements can help maintain and manage these difficult skin conditions. My one friend found that drinking Zrii with Amalaki juice helped tame her flare ups.
Similarly, soaking the body in a kelp based bath is very soothing and detoxifying and cleansing. You can find kelp powder at the local natural store in the herb section. About a 1/2 cup can be diluted in you tub. Adding tea tree essential oil to this bath is especially healing.
Occasionally a colloidal oatmeal bath is also help. Oatmeal is very calming and soothing to the skin. I remember getting an oatmeal bath when I had the chicken pox when I was 8.
To help control the extreme itch associated with eczema and psoriasis try out this natural receipe:
Mix together in a bowl:
one-teaspoonful of comfrey root
one-teaspoon of slippery elm bark
one-teaspoon of white bark
two cups of water
Boil the mixture for approximately thirty-five minutes and then allow it to cool. Use this mixture as a skin wash and wash the affected skin with it. It may not completely remove the itch, but it will decrease it dramatically.

One of the Best Natural Facial Masks- Moisturize & Brighten Your Skin Naturally

Today, I am doing my "all natural" skin care home spa day. I prepare all natural facial products and treat, condition and care for my face, body and hair.
I wanted to share one particular recipe that works wonders. Over any facial mask on the market, my egg mask works wonders. It is one that costs about $.20 to make and will keep you skin youthful, tight and glowing.
I have 3 variations depending on skin type and season:

Egg Mask for dry skin:
Mix together 1 raw egg and 1 tablespoon of honey. Spreak on your face and neck, and let sit for 15-20 minutes. Rinse well with tepid water. It is a great moisturizing mask.
Egg Mask for oily skin:
Mix together 1 raw egg and 1 tablespoon of ground oatmeal. Spread on your face and neck, and let sit for 15-20 minutes. Rinse well with tepid water. The mask is good for removing blackheads.
Egg Mask for normal skin:
Mix together 1 raw egg and 1 tablespoon of fresh sour cream. Sour cream is rich in lactic acid and helps soften and remove surface impurities. It will remove dead skin cells, leaving your skin soft and smooth. Spread on your face and neck, and let sit for 15-20 minutes. Rinse well with tepid water.
This can be messy and drippy...but within 3 or 4 minutes the mixture starts to dry a bit.

Aloe: Nature's Miracle Plant. From Curing Dandruf to Gas

While eating my breakfast this morning, Good Morning America had a special on natural remedies in our homes. One of the items they featured was aloe. When I was growing up- my mom used aloe for just about every problem I had. It helped me ease a sunburn, sooth my upset stomach, heal skin from acne and regulate my menstrual cycle.
The Aloe plant is one of the richest kitchen garden plants in healing properties and has been even been nicknamed named the “first-aid” plant. It has moisturizing and emollient properties and is used in cosmetic creams, shaving creams, sun screens and facial masks.
Many Cosmetologists utilize aloe as a key natural beauty ingredient with several other herb. The best tip I can suggest is to grow your own aloe plant. They are very reliable plants and you can then use the fresh gel. This is much more effective than bottled gel,as it is fresh, natural and more potent. It is the only plant whose extract is applied directly from plant to face in its natural and purest form.
VARYING USES OF ALOE IN HEALTH AND BEAUTY
Aloe as after-shave
Fresh aloe gel should be rubbed on after shaving. Razor burns diminish and cuts heal quickly without scarring.
Aloe for a glowing skin
Spread aloe gel on your face. Within minutes, it works by clearing blemishes and giving you a fresh, soft baby look, which other chemicals and concoctions fail to do. Drinking 10 ml aloe juice daily also helps cleanse your skin.
Aloe for a wrinkle-free skin
Aloe is known to combat wrinkles and defies ageing. Cosmetologists have hailed it as the “water of youth”. Aloe Vera gel penetrates quickly & deeply and it is retained by the skin 3 to 4 times faster than water. Its enzymes remove dead cells, grow new ones, provide moisture and nutrition, get rid of dryness and restore the skin’s elasticity.
Aloe for acne
Aloe, the wonder herb clears acne by removing the dead cells, thereby opening the skin pores and discarding the blocked oil. The scars left by acne also should be treated similarly using aloe.
Aloe as sunscreen
Aloe provides an effective sunscreen against both types of ultraviolet rays (UV-A which causes premature ageing & UV-B which causes sunburn and skin darkening) of the sun. The pulp of aloe juice along with turmeric removes sunburn & reduces oiliness.
Aloe for burning sensation in the eyes
Sometimes there is a strong burning sensation and redness in the eyes due to factors like long hours in the hot sun, too much eye-strain due to computer usage etc. Here the pulp of the aloe juice placed on each eye can help cool the eyes and rid them of this sensation
Aloe for radiant hair
Mix fresh aloe gel mixed with curds (for very oil hair you can add multani mitti (fuller’s earth) also) and apply it to the hair ½ an hour before bath. It will make your hair bouncy & lustrous.
Aloe for dandruff
You can directly use Aloe Vera gel to remove excess dandruff. Apply the gel on your scalp 10-15 minutes before you plan to wash your hair. Regular use of the gel before shampooing will keep down the growth of dandruff.
Aloe for menstrual irregularities
Menstrual irregularities are frequent among woman. Prepare an extract of aloe juice & boil it with sugar to make syrup. Intake of this aloe syrup one week before the due date of menses is a good remedy for delayed menses. Papaya is also useful in delayed periods.
Aloe for painful menses
Some women have painful menses. The same syrup as mentioned above should be used during menses. It improves pelvic circulation and removes spasm. This will help to ease pain caused during menses.
Aloe for osteoarthritis
The use of aloe is indicated in many geriatric problems such as neuromuscular weakness and osteoarthritis. Intake of 10 gm of aloe with half a gram of turmeric powder acts as an effective blood purifier.
Aloe for wounds, bruises & abrasions
Aloe gel hardens into a natural bandage due to its antiseptic, antibacterial and antifungal properties and is widely used for the external treatment or minor wound and inflammatory skin disorders, cuts, bruises and abrasions.
Aloe for burns
Aloe has been traditionally used as a natural remedy for burns-like first degree and second degree thermal burns, and to this effect, the plant is also called “burn plant”.
Aloe for gas trouble
Mixing a dish of aloe by roasting it in a small quantity of ghee and taking it once or twice a week with a meal is a common practice in rural India. This recipe is helpful in cases of chronic gas trouble and distension of abdomen.
Aloe for losing weight
There is good news for weight watchers. Aloin, the active principle of aloe, has been in anti-obesity preparations too.
